A downtown Santa Fe shop worker has been accused of assault and the shop owner has criticized the police response—saying that their handling of the case was insufficient.
The annual International Folk Art Market started today with an invitation-only parade — it will continue through Sunday at the Santa Fe Railyard Market.
Jack Lain, a longtime educator + administrator who taught in several New Mexico school districts, is running for a seat on Santa Fe Public Schools District 5.
PNM announced a fridge recycling program for its customers—with a free pickup and a $75 check for each full-size unit, limited to two per household.
The program removes hazardous chemicals from old fridges and has recycled over 25,000 units since 2020.
